Snap's AR glasses are getting a better browser and support for Spotlight video

Snap is upgrading the software powering its augmented reality (AR) glasses, Specs, in preparation for the release of a non-developer version next year. The latest update to Snap OS includes an improved web browser and the ability to browse Spotlight videos in AR. The company aims to enable users to spend less time staring at their phones through these new features. The browser has been redesigned for easier site switching and window resizing, as well as improved power efficiency and longer video playback time. Additionally, Spectacles will now have a dedicated lens for browsing Snapchat's Spotlight short-form video platform, and a new gallery lens for quickly previewing and scrolling through photos taken with the glasses' camera. While the current Specs are only available to developers, Snap plans to release a smaller, lighter, and more capable pair of glasses to the public in 2026.
